How it all started…….. • Study tours (not ‘holidays’) 15+yrs • Initially, 4 or so a year. • Feedback always positive • Lots of staff time within TC • Intense experience • Dropped to 1 or 2 tours per year: India, Kenya • 6 years ago started talking to Skedaddle about alternative approach
A new approach – ‘Meet The People’ • Our aim is to build understanding: • Of fair trade and its impact, difficulties and successes • The producers, their countries and culture • The broader issues people face • See a country, its natural beauty and wildlife • And have a great holiday with like minded people • ….develop producers understanding of us • …and develop experience of fair trade tourism
A new approach – ‘Meet the People’ • Responsible / Fair trade approach • Transparency • Fair return • Long term relationship • Partnership with Local TO’s & Guides • Partners / producers benefit / get support • Feedback from Producers through TC • A commercial approach (TC model)
A new approach – ‘Meet the People’ • Careful development of itineraries • Remote areas off the tourist trail • Briefing and reunions are key part of the experience • Light footprint / responsible travel • Small number of departures, small group max 12 to 14 • Not mass tourism • Responsible Travel Policy / Travellers Code • Carbon Off-setting for flights (customer optional)
The story so far…….. • 1 to 12 tours - ‘02 & ‘07, 350 customers in last 5 yrs • Destinations • India, Thailand, Bangladesh, South Africa, Malawi, Kenya • Cuba, Philippines, Sri Lanka • NEW - Peru, Vietnam, Central America/Coffee, Ghana / Cocoa • Feedback - 97% Excellent / Very Happy • 65% of spend in in local economy • Donations to producers, projects • Customers gone on to help projects • Customers gone on to give talks / spread the word • We are getting there…..

The Worlds largest Industry • Employs 200+ million people (8%) • 8% + of worlds GDP • 65 out of 69 of the LDC biggest FC earner • Predicted to double by 2020 • FT tourism 10 years behind commodities
Problems of International Tourism • Cultural conflict • Working conditions • Displacement • Water shortages • Environmental impact • Exploitation of women / sex tourism
